1964 Fordson Super Dexta, New Performance, built March 12th 1964. Engine is a
Ford/Perkins F3.152 rated at 44.5 hp. Do not be fooled by the Perkins designation,
although some parts are interchangeable with Perkins engines, others are not. All
castings were made at Dagenham and shipped to Perkins for assembly.

Good sturdy little tractor but it has a couple of weak areas, always use antifreeze in
the radiator as there is an area of the block behind the injection pump that traps
coolant and does not drain. People have been caught out by draining the radiator in a
cold spell and having the water freeze and crack the block at this point. The other
point is that the bottoms of the gear sticks where they go into the selectors, wear and
allow the levers to jump out of the selectors. Easy job, just take out the four bolts
and put them back in, The sticks can be buit up with a bit of weld or new sticks are
available.

They are great little tractors and about the only down side was they did not come with power steering. Otherwise, a live pto, live hydraulics, very thrifty on fuel, tons of power, lots of maneuverability, dual range transmission, all in a small package. Fairly comparable to the Ford 3000 that came next. At least the one I had, of which I passed down to other family members.

If it is a Super Dexta then the first 3 characters of the serial number have to be 09B, 09C or 09D. In all cases the number after that has to have 6 digits, so I am betting that you are missing the final digit, and any serial number starting with 09D92 would be a 1964 serial number.
